What are the opposite words for good-heartedly?

Good-heartedly, a commonly used adverb that describes the sincerity of one's actions, can have various antonyms. These include actions or behaviors that are insincere, malicious, selfish, or callous. Words such as selfishly, maliciously, unkindly, cruelly, heartlessly, and insincerely are antonyms that indicate the opposite of good-heartedness. One may act selfishly by putting their interests or desires before others, while acting maliciously, cruelly, or heartlessly implies causing harm or pain intentionally. Finally, being insincere suggests that one's actions are motivated by hidden agendas or dishonesty, rather than being genuinely good-hearted. In summary, antonyms for good-heartedly are actions and behaviors that are insincere or motivated by negative intentions.
